High voltage links over-crossing Europe

Description
This is a study about the beneficial aspects and the problems raised by the implementation of a high voltage interconnecting system in Europe. There are stressed advantages as: leveling of the demand curves on account of the different local time, general distribution of the hydroelectric power produced in the northern part of the continent, reducing of the average electric energy costs by eliminating the intermediate agents. As for the environmental impact such a network could be a solution to the following problems: balancing the water resources, the waste water disposal and its treatment, reducing pollution and diminishing the greenhouse effect, acid rains and dangerous gas emission.
